Sarcomas currently represent 1% of adult malignancies and 15% of pediatric malignancies. To determine the prevalence of
HER-2/neu
overexpression by the histologic type and to identify a possible predictive role in patients with sarcoma, we performed a retrospective study on subjects with a biopsy-proven diagnosis of a soft tissue sarcoma.
HER-2/neu
overexpression was evaluated using immunohistochemistry (IHC) performed on paraffin-embedded specimens. An IHC score of 2+ or greater was considered positive for overexpression. Two hundred seventy-three patients with soft tissue sarcoma were identified (164 females, 109 males) with a mean age of 56 (range: 1-93). The most common tumors identified were
malignant fibrous histiocytoma
(
MFH
) (18.3%), dermatofibrosarcoma (DFS) (16.1%), leiomyosarcoma (13.2%) and carcinosarcomas (CS) (7.3%). Of the 273 specimens, 29 (10.6%) revealed
HER-2/neu
overexpression. CS,
MFH
, and DFS specimens showed the highest incidence of
HER-2/neu
overexpression (40%, 26%, and 18.2%, respectively). The incidence of
HER-2/neu
overexpression was found to be significantly higher in patients with a survival of less than 8 months (p = 0.035). This demonstrates that
HER-2/neu
overexpression is preferentially seen in certain soft tissue sarcomas, and when present is associated with a poorer prognosis in patients with sarcoma. Further studies would delineate whether
HER-2/neu
overexpression renders sarcomas chemoresistant and thus adversely affects outcome. In addition, there may be a role for Herceptin (trastuzumab) alone, or in combination with conventional therapy, in patients with CS, MHF, and DFS.

Carcinosarcomas (CS) of the prostate are very uncommon neoplasms defined by the admixture of malignant epithelial and mesenchymal components. We describe here two new examples of CS in two patients aged 66 and 77 years, the first without previous history of prostate adenocarcinoma and the second with a 5-year history of acinar type prostate adenocarcinoma. The diagnosis of CS was made on the cystoprostatectomy specimen in the first case and transurethral resection in the second case. Both biphasic tumours exhibited papillary areas of ductal differentiation and conventional adenocarcinoma in the epithelial component, as well as
malignant fibrous histiocytoma
and angiosarcomatous areas in the first case and solid, poorly differentiated epithelial areas with neuroendocrine features in the second case. Immunohistochemistry revealed over-expression of
c-erb B2
in the papillary epithelial component of both cases, whereas the solid undifferentiated epithelial areas in the second patient expressed c-kit, CD10 and synaptophysin, thus conforming a very undifferentiated cell population. The angiosarcomatous component of the first case expressed CD31 and CD10. The clinical course of the cases was divergent; the first patient is free of disease after radical surgery and adjuvant therapy and the other died 5 months after the diagnosis of CS, having already developed liver metastases.
